I have completed a preliminary review for the above-referenced proposal. The following comments are based on the pre-application submittal made to the City of Renton by the applicant. Water 1. A Reduced Pressure Backflow Assembly (RPBA) will be required to be installed inline of the domestic water meter to the building in an above ground insulated “hot box”, per City standard. City records do not show a backflow device is installed at the meter at this time. 2. The existing backflow device installed on the fire service line does not meet current Department of Health standards. The check valve assembly will need to be replaced with a double detector check valve (DDCVA) to meet current standards. The device shall be installed outside in a vault or inside the building in accordance with City of Renton standards. 3. The Development Regulations are available for purchase for $100.00 plus tax, from the Finance Division on the first floor of City Hall or online at www.rentonwa.gov Project Proposal: The subject property is located at 71 SW Victoria Street (APN 1823059017). The project site slopes upward from east to west. The property is zoned Residential – 10 dwelling units per acre (R-10) and is 48,800 square feet (1.12 acres) in size. The applicant is proposing to remodel an existing assisted living facility to provide “memory care”. The remodeling proposal encompasses extensive internal changes to the first floor of the building with more minor changes to the second floor of the three story structure. Work to the outside of the facility would include additional ramps and replacing the existing rockery in the southeast portion of the property. Current Use: The property is developed with an existing three story assisted living facility. Zoning Requirements: The subject property is zoned Residential-10 dwelling units per acre (R-10). Assisted living facilities are permitted in the R-10 zone subject to an approved Administrative Conditional Use Permit. The subject facility has been located on the subject property since 1981. A copy of these standards is included. Access/Parking: The applicant is not proposing any changes to existing access or parking. Landscaping: Remodeling of structures that requires improvements equal to or greater than 50% of the assessed property valuation must comply with all requirements of RMC 4-4-070 Landscaping. These landscaping requirements would apply to the entire site including parking areas. Critical Areas: The project site does not contain any mapped critical areas. Environmental Review: The proposed project is categorically exempt from Environmental (SEPA) Review. Permit Requirements: The proposal would not require any land use permits. Applicable construction and building permits would be required. A handout listing all of the City’s development related fees is attached.
